Men’s and Women’s Wrestling Reach National Championship Meet in First Year of Competition

Posted April 01, 2022

Members from both the men’s and women’s wrestling teams qualified for national-level competition in the program’s first season over the winter.The E&H men sent four wrestlers to the NCWA National Championships while one woman qualified for the NCWWA National Championships. Freshman Levi Field (Manassas, Va.) became the program’s first All-American, taking seventh place in the 157-pound weight class. On the women’s side, junior Andreia Langley (Chilhowie, Va.) was one bout away from receiving All-America honors, tying for ninth place at 191 pounds.
